evaporators are typically under a vacuum in order to reduce the boiling point of water . without vacuum water boils at a temperature of 100 degre celcius. but with vacuum it boils at 83.5 degre celcuis. what is the percent change in the boiling temperature with addition of vacuum. show each step

Answer:

There is a reduction of 16.5% in the boiling temperature due to addition of vacuum.

Step-by-step explanation:

Water boils at 100 degree Celsius without vacuum.

With the addition of vacuum, the boiling temperature reduces to 83.5 degree Celsius.

The total reduction in boiling temperature is [tex]100 - 83.5 = 16.5[/tex] degree Celsius.

At first, the boiling temperature was 100 degree Celsius, which reduces by 16.5 degree Celsius.

The change in percentage is [tex]\frac{16.5}{100} \times100 = 16.5[/tex].
